Specification parameters
Bowl Capacity:≈250ML
Rated Voltage:3.7V
Rated Current :10A
Charging Voltage: 5V
Charging Current :0.3A
Using Your Mini Food processor
1.Before first use, do plug and fully charge the unit, and the red light's on when charging while off if full. Clean
the blade, chopping cup and splash guard(lid) before the first use.
2.Insert the chopping blade onto the centering shaft in the processing bowl. Be careful when handling the
sharp blades. Add food to be processed into the glass processing bowl (below the max line).
3.After then insert the lid onto the bowl, then put the motor head on and zip to the lid on place. Push the
switch and start to process the good. The blades will be blocked if it is overloaded when start. Do reduce the
amount of the food then go on.
4. Release the switch about 15 seconds after one cycle processing. Please continue to press and push the
switch for another cycle if the food is not fine enough. After processing, remove the motor head, and then
take off the splash guard from cup, pour out the food. Do cleaning on the blades, splash guard and bowl.
